Storing components
If you do not install your S4100–ON Series (S4128F-ON and S4148F-ON) swtich and components immediately, properly store the switch
and all optional components following these guidelines:
Storage location temperature must remain constant. The storage range is from -40° to 149°F (-40° to 65°C).
Store on a dry surface or oor, away from direct sunlight, heat, and air conditioning ducts.
Store in a dust-free environment.
NOTE: ESD damage can occur when components are mishandled. Always wear an ESD-preventive wrist or heel ground strap
when handling the S4100–ON Series switch and its accessories. After you remove the original packaging, place the switch and
its components on an anti-static surface.
